Tender Overview

BPCL invites O&M services for the Biogas Plant at Mahul refinery, Mumbai for a three-year term. The project scope covers operation and maintenance of the biogas facility at BPCL's Mumbai, Maharashtra location. The bid includes an EMD of ₹250,000 and allows contract quantity/duration adjustments up to 25%. An excess settlement option permits additional charges within a defined percentage, supported by required documentation. This opportunity targets experienced service providers capable of sustaining uninterrupted biogas operations in a refinery setting. The BOQ shows no line items, indicating a consolidated service contract. The tender emphasizes contractual flexibility and compliance with BPCL procurement norms.
